Hu Guangzhen (Chinese: 胡光镇; 26 August 1927 – 23 January 2023) was a Chinese electronic engineer, and an academician of the Chinese Academy of Engineering.

Honours and awards

  • 1996 State Science and Technology Progress Award (Special)
  • 1997 Member of the Chinese Academy of Engineering (CAE)
  • 2001 State Science and Technology Progress Award (Special)
